Ferdinand Magellan underestimated the size of the Pacific Ocean and thought that the Spice Islands were only a few days away. However, the voyage lasted about four months. Magellan was the first to circumnavigate the world and cross the Pacific. He set out on this expedition voyage in 1519.
Pacific means peaceful or quiet. The Pacific Ocean was named by Ferdinand Magellan. It took him three months to sail through the peaceful calm waters, which was why he called it the Pacific Ocean.
